Where can i get this?

*Side Note, don't use a slug in your house. There is no telling what may behind the intruder at the time you fire. Meaning your wife, child, or loved one's room may be on the other side of that wall if you miss, and I'm betting your neighbor doesn't want that wake-up call should that slug go through a window. Stick to heavy bird shot or "00" at the most.
